Glass vases

Fiskars Home Oy Ab / Iittala

The fluidity and vibrant feel of the mouth blown glass creates the delicate character for the new Iittala collectible vase Ruutu. Created by Ronan and Erwan Bouroullec, Ruutu might be simple in shape but it takes the most skilled craftsmen in the glass factory to produce. Ruutu, which means diamond or square in Finnish, is a collection of 10 vases available in five sizes and seven colors. When collected and combined, they make small seamless installations where both the strength and the delicate nature of the glass come alive. Each vase is a simplified masterpiece taking seven craftsmen 24 hours to produce in the Iittala glass factory.

JURY STATEMENT

Touched by Nordic Design - selected by Dorrit Bøilerehauge Iittala’s colorful range of Ruutu vases in different sizes forms a sensory symphony ready for exploration and expression. The depth of the colors adds substance to the glass, and the prismatic shapes signal consideration for sculptural and aesthetic values. The designers Ronan and Erwan Bouroullec add new dimensions to the classic Nordic universe, with the diamond shapes and as many as 10 different colors, all adding their own perspectives to the purity of the material. The Ruutu vases, which are so much more than merely vessels, bear testimony to artisan craftsmanship and design history while using contemporary shapes.
